A warning to new players...

Archive: 7 posts


It amazes me the number of posts I see from players complaining that their profile has been corrupted by some horrible glitch, and they now face the prospect of having to start the whole game again from scratch because they didn't back up their save.

So, let's establish this fact right now. LBP2 is jam-packed with potentially game destroying bugs and glitches, and we are all at risk of losing our story progress and personal creations any time we play this game. You can protect yourself however, by adopting a mindset right from the beginning.

Every time you quit create mode and return to your pod, save a backup of the level you were working on.

Every time you complete a level and earn new prizes, or whenever it comes to the end of a play session and you are going to bed for the night, back up your profile.

Rotate your saves using multiple files. Do not run the risk of overwriting your only good profile with corrupt data. PS3 has one hell of a lot of memory space to save your stuff, so use it.

For an added sense of security, I would also advise you to publish a locked version of your work in progress level at the end of each create session.

Doing these things may add an extra minute or two to your overall play time each day, but when you finally get hit by that bug that destroys everything you have worked so hard towards, those back up saves will be worth more to you than pure gold.

I know that to many LBP veterans , these precautions will already be second nature, but we also have a steady flow of newcomers who may not be aware of the risks, so to them I say....you have been warned!
